Hi,

I was wondering if anyone can recommend any London music colleges for a bachelor degree in a musical performance course. I've recently been inspired to return back to my roots to play the piano - in Australia I achieved Grade 6 AMEB (10 years ago), not sure what the equivalent is here - there is no way in hell I would be near that standard now and would take me many many months if not a year to get back to that technical standard. Of course I would need to find a good tutor in London as well. Perhaps my long term goal is to one day have the qualification to be able to teach music. Why I put myself through studying an accounting CPA qualification I have no idea Smile It's just not my passion and I now have the burning desire to study music..something I should have done long ago. Can anyone recommend quality evening courses?

Thanks for your help.

Trinity/Guildhall College of Music, London
London College of Music
Universities: eg.,Royal Holloway at Egham (part of University College London)
Associated Board of the Royal Schools of Music - qualifications from DipABRSM up to Masters equivalent
EPTA - European Piano Teachers Association
